description | An electric energy generating module is shaped to take on a desired two dimensional profile to match a non-flat surface or architectural element such as corrugated roofing. The module includes an electric energy generating film sealed between a top layer of encapsulant material and a bottom layer of encapsulant material. The type and quantity of the encapsulant materials are such that the shape of the encapsulant materials can be altered when a high temperature and/or pressure is applied to the module, but where the encapsulant materials provide a rigid structure around the electric energy generating film under ordinary (i.e., naturally occurring) temperature and pressure conditions. The module can therefore be shaped by applying a suitable pressure and/or a high temperature but, once placed under ordinary temperature and pressure conditions, the module has a rigid structure. |
